Mary Anning has lots of stories to tell you about her life as a pioneering nineteenth-century fossil hunter in Lyme Regis. Did you know she helped discover the first ichthyosaur when she was only 12 years old? Meet her in the galleries and discover more about her life and her important fossil discoveries that helped reconstruct the world’s past.
 
The learning themes for this activity are adaptation to the environment, ideas and evidence in science.
It is suitable for Key Stage 2.
